Understanding Tree Protection Netting

Tree protection netting. What’s the deal? It’s not just a fad; it’s essential. This protective mesh, constructed from high-quality UV-stabilized HDPE (High-Density Polyethylene), is designed to safeguard trees during construction activities. It provides an effective barrier that minimizes damage from dust, debris, and other potential hazards.

The Mechanics of Protection

Imagine a bustling construction site. Heavy machinery operates nearby. Trees stand tall—an oasis of nature amid the chaos. This is where tree protection netting comes into play. The open mesh structure facilitates airflow while blocking harmful elements. Incredibly, it allows natural light to penetrate, which is crucial for the health of the tree.

  • Durability: High-density polyethylene ensures longevity.
  • Weather Resistance: Works in extreme conditions.
  • Lightweight: Easy installation without heavy equipment.
